Course Overview
This ILT
Series course teaches participants about organizational leadership
and its role in guiding the organization toward vision fulfillment.
Participants will learn how to define an organization's vision,
draft a vision statement and communicate it, set goals that are
aligned with an organization's vision, and discuss the importance of
planning changes before implementing them. Course activities also
cover providing employees for organizational changes, motivating
employees through change, solving problems encountered during
change, and helping employees deal with grief and stress during
changes. Participants will also learn how leaders can help employees
learn their roles in organizations, align their goals with those of
the organization, and help prevent employee apathy.
